also helps to spray all your rubber with silicone and if the lock is frozen, use your lighter to heat the key up.... heat it, put it in, let is sit a minute, repeat

Silicone is a good idea, but it will come off on your hands and clothing and I dont know about you guys, but I absolutely can't stand the dry weird feeling that silicone spray/paste leaves on my hands .

A better idea, and I'm not kidding: Chapstick. It leaves no film behind, and it works beautifully.
Buy whatever kind you want, I used the regular Chapstick brand with the black label, but if you want to go all out and get Cherry flavored, go right ahead. ;)
